A member asked:

Yesterday my 12 yr old got a meningitis & hpv shots. her arm is really swollen is this normal or should l have her checked out by a dr.?

Conservative Rx: Swelling of the arm sometimes occurs after a vaccine but is generally not serious. The swelling generally recedes after a few days. A cold compress may help with the discomfort. The swelling and soreness may benefit from an over-the-counter anti-inflammatory medication such as ibuprofen or acetaminophen. However, do not give aspirin. If this problem persists check it out with your child's doctor.
